Transaction 8639c108364b1f94dee627b4bea7ad0059beb9a24781a0010133d94e8aa3f777
1 Input
1 Output
-
8639c108364b1f94dee627b4bea7ad0059beb9a24781a0010133d94e8aa3f777:0
- value
- 640741
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d871ed0895759341b11659f78807de3c50fee127 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LjTS9VubfEKiDY8rU7ZuymV1bDbSc1FNy